The idea is simple. I guess most of us will agree that coldfusionbloggers is a defacto instance that tells us how much movement there is in ColdFusion Community for a particular day by the number of posts that are agregated. Yes, not all there are 100% relevant but still this is an estimate. At least the best i could think of. So, starting on 03-07-2011 i started time to time to ping cfbloggers and calculate the number of posts for each day. The numbers may not be fully accurate taking in mind time difference, downsides etc, but still should be pretty close. So, i took that numbers and put on a chart getting so a kind of pulse of the coldfusion community. This being said, please welcome cfPulse...

ColdFusion is at version 9 already but we still seem to have problems where i would believe all has to be nice for years. I'm talking about CFHTTP tag here. Yesterday i had to make for a client a script that will connect to a site login move to other internal page from where data should be taken So what the usual process would be in such a case? make a CFHTTP request using the cookies from previous step, if any exists, make the CFHTTP call with login credentials using the cookies from previous step (here should be present session cookies), make the CFHTTP call to the internal page do with the data whatever you need Sometimes step 1 may not be needed. Everything looks fine so far and in most of the cases works as supposed, but NOT everytime. Sometimes on step 3 instead of going to the internal page it "lose the session" and as result you get there the login page instead. This is exactly what happened for me for this particular client. After over 2 years, cfHSSF has been updated. It has been done by Steven Durette and he did a really great job! From his email: I made a couple more additions and I set it up so that it would degrade gracefully if the version of POI isn't high enough to support the features. I also made a change to the way values are set in cells. Before a row was created every time a cell value was set. With newer versions of POI if a cell already existed in a row, it was wiped out when another cell in the same row was set. The new method first checks to see if the row exists and uses that. If the row doesn't exist then it creates it. The ability to put JPEG and PNG images into workbooks was added. This works with the POI included with CF9. If someone tries to use it that doesn't have a new enough version, it takes the cell where the image was to reside and places a message that the POI version doesn't support it.
